Analysis

Madagascar recorded 1,400 for use of interpolation and extrapolation on original gini coefficient data in 2017.

The figure is up 9.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, use of interpolation and extrapolation on original gini coefficient data in Madagascar peaked at 1,954 in 1970 and was at its lowest, 748.12, in 1850.

That places Madagascar 153rd out of 160 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 15 years of available data.

In order to produce global estimates of historical poverty trends we have interpolated or extrapolated inequality data for missing observations. Green indicates observations of the Gini coefficient available in the original source.
